'baked earth ' is the literal meaning of the building material 'terracotta' A type of fired clay, typically of a brownish-red colour and unglazed, used as an ornamental building material and in modelling. origin- Early 18th century: from Italian terra cotta 'baked earth', from Latin terra cocta.

Terracotta, terra cotta or terra-cotta (Italian: "baked earth",[1] from the Latin terra cotta), a type of earthenware, is a clay-based unglazed or glazed ceramic,[2] where the fired body is porous.[3][4][5][6] Its uses include vessels (notably flower pots), water and waste water pipes, bricks, and surface embellishment in building construction, along with sculpture such as the Terracotta Army and Greek terracotta figurines. The term is also used to refer to items made out of this material and to its natural, brownish orange color, which varies considerably. In archaeology and art history, "terracotta" is often used to describe objects such as figurines, not made on a potter's wheel. Objects made on a wheel from the same material, are called pottery; the choice of term depends on the type of object rather than the material Refer the link: http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Terracotta. read less

Baked earth refers to 'terrecotta' what is generally seen in Indian pottery, bricks used in building construction and some sculptures. Most roofs of traditional Indian homes were made of terracotta tiles as they could withstand adverse climates while maintaining a cool interior of the building. Pieces of terracotta are used as heterogenous catalysts and is considered useful in the production of gasoline\petrol. read less
